For the fourth consecutive year, Concordia led the Great Plains Athletic Conference in the number of NAIA Scholar-Athletes. Concordia, one of 13 GPAC teams, accounted for 54 of 401 scholar-athletes in the conference.

In the last four years Concordia has had 188 student-athletes garner the NAIA Scholar-Athlete award. 

In order to receive the honor, players must carry a cumulative grade point average of 3.5 on a 4.0 scale and be junior or above in academic standing.

Scholar-athlete numbers by sport for Concordia in 2006-2007: 
 
Women’s Cross Country: 1
Men’s Cross Country: 3
Football: 8
Men’s Soccer: 2
Women’s Soccer: 1
Volleyball: 5
Women’s Basketball: 7
Men’s Basketball: 2
Women’s Track: 6
Men’s Track: 5
Men’s Tennis: 2
Women’s Tennis: 1
Women’s Golf: 3
Baseball: 3
Softball: 5
